What affects the price

Kitchen remodeling costs change based on the scope of your vision. Opting for custom cabinetry or high-end stone countertops will move the price up, while sticking with standard layouts and materials keeps the budget lower. Removing walls, updating plumbing, or changing your floor plan adds labor time and complexity to the project. What are the pros and cons of butcher block countertops in Kansas City?

Butcher block countertops offer a warm, natural look that many appreciate in Kansas City kitchens. They are relatively affordable and can be sanded and refinished if damaged. However, they require regular sealing to prevent staining and water damage. They can also be prone to scratches and dents. A specialist can advise on proper care and maintenance.

Are ready-to-assemble cabinets worth considering in Kansas City?

Ready-to-assemble (RTA) cabinets can be a cost-effective option for Kansas City residents. They often come at a lower price point than pre-assembled cabinets. However, they require assembly, which can be time-consuming. The quality can vary significantly between brands.
